I've chosen to refresh my setup and plan to install a Ryzen 5900X and an RTX 3080 (or possibly an RX 6000 if availability stays tight). For the motherboard, I'm leaning toward a B550 model since it eliminates the need for a chipset fan, reducing noise and potential points of failure. However, I'm concerned about sacrificing performance beyond the PCIe 4.0 lanes provided by the X570 chipset. Overclocking will require a board with solid VRM support.
